The course modules cover:
- What is Deprivation of Liberty?
- Authorising a Deprivation of Liberty
- The Safeguards
- The Importance of Record Keeping
This is a 30 minute course.
This online training course explains what needs to be done before a deprivation of liberty can be authorised. It is designed for the use of any delegate who cares for someone who may lack the mental capacity to make decisions for themselves.
